The Unviersity of Michigan, School of Nursing (UMSN) is looking for a temporary office assistant with a positivie outlook and flexible attitude to perform a combination of front desk reception and proctoring duties.
Proctoring duites include:
- Checks identification before testing and seats examinees for testing
- Monitors students during test sessions to ensure a secure testing environment
- Distribute and collect test materials
- Reports suspected irregularities to the testing coordinator
- Controls admission to and from the testing room
- Completes exam proctoring check-off sheet
- Performs other duities as assigned
